Powder Blue & Peach

This palette just couldn’t be any prettier or more perfect for a Spring (or Summer!) wedding. The crisp powder blue is delicate and surprisingly feminine (with stock and blue thistle coming in the perfect shades), whilst the soft shades of peach adds contrast and warmth. Complete the look with plenty of greenery like Eucalyptus, lambs ear, and trailing jasmine to complete this floral flourish…..

Ethereal Greenery

A stunning wedding palette inspired by the current greenery trend and so perfect for Spring! Soft shades of lush green, with splashes of warm yellow and nude couldn’t be more elegant or more romantic. And whilst it would most definitely suit a boho bride and garden setting, it would also look oh so chic for a sophisticated bride in a more formal venue. Just think sweeping staircases, opulent florals, candelabras, and chandeliers over stately tables….. very Downton Abbey!
